TrumpyNor Posted October 31, 2017 #5 Share Posted October 31, 2017 (edited) What date did Latitudes stop extra points for booking 9 months early? They started that sometime in the beginning of February 2017, if I remember correctly. But if you had bookings that was done before that date, where the reservation was done min. 9 months in advance, then you would still get the extra points. If the reservation was done on or after that date in February, then there were no extra point for booking 9 months early. Edit: Yes, it is correct that it was February 3rd, 2017. Here is a link to the Latitudes FAQ's where it states that (Quote: For 2017 cruises that were booked prior to February 3, 2017, the additional point will still apply; any cruise booked on or after February 3, 2017 will not qualify for the extra point. End of quote): https://www.ncl.com/no/en/latitudes-rewards-program/faq (under the headline "Does the refreshed program affect the way I earn points?")
